Domitian, as Caesar, 69-81. Denarius (Silver, 20 mm, 3.49 g, 6 h), Rome, 79. CAESAR AVG F DOMITIANVS COS VI Laureate head of Domitian to right. Rev. PRINCEPS IVVENTVTIS Salus standing right with her legs crossed, resting her left arm on column, holding serpent in her right hand and patera in her left. BMC 265. Cohen 384. RIC 1084. Nicely toned. Minor flan fault on the obverse, otherwise, good very fine.

From the Michael Landt Collection, ex Leu Web Auction 15, 27 February 2021, 1722.
